re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

tools/clang/lib/Lex/ModuleMap.cpp
  182     auto File = SourceMgr.getFileManager().getFile(Filename);
  303   auto File = SourceMgr.getFileManager().getFile(Path);
  416   StringRef DirName = SourceMgr.getFileManager().getCanonicalName(Dir);
  433     if (auto DirEntry = SourceMgr.getFileManager().getDirectory(DirName))
  761     if (auto DirEntry = SourceMgr.getFileManager().getDirectory(DirName))
  854   auto *MainFile = SourceMgr.getFileEntryForID(SourceMgr.getMainFileID());
  854   auto *MainFile = SourceMgr.getFileEntryForID(SourceMgr.getMainFileID());
  923       SourceMgr.getFileManager().getCanonicalName(FrameworkDir);
  936   FileManager &FileMgr = SourceMgr.getFileManager();
 1113     Cb->moduleMapAddUmbrellaHeader(&SourceMgr.getFileManager(), UmbrellaHeader);
 1228   return SourceMgr.getFileEntryForID(
 1229            SourceMgr.getFileID(Module->DefinitionLoc));
 2978     ID = SourceMgr.createFileID(File, ExternModuleLoc, FileCharacter);
 2982   const llvm::MemoryBuffer *Buffer = SourceMgr.getBuffer(ID);
 2989   Lexer L(SourceMgr.getLocForStartOfFile(ID), MMapLangOpts,
 2994   ModuleMapParser Parser(L, SourceMgr, Target, Diags, *this, File, Dir,
 3000     auto Loc = SourceMgr.getDecomposedLoc(Parser.getLocation());